Sub-Slab Depressurization (SSD) Systems

The gold-standard mitigation method for Riverlea's typical poured-basement and slab-on-grade homes along Olentangy Boulevard and Hayhurst Drive. We cut a single suction point through the slab, seal slab penetrations, and run a 4-inch PVC riser to a quiet exterior fan that vents above the roofline. Post-install pCi/L readings are typically 0.4–1.5.

Crawlspace and Mixed-Foundation Mitigation

Many older Riverlea homes near the Olentangy River have partial crawlspaces. We install reinforced vapor barrier membranes sealed to the foundation walls, then tie sub-membrane suction into the main mitigation stack. One system, one fan, one re-test.

Our Radon Mitigation Process — From Test Result to Re-Test

radon mitigation pipe installation basement OhioPhoto by AI Generated (Grok Imagine)

Riverlea customers consistently tell us the same thing: every other contractor gave them a different price and a different timeline. Here is exactly how our process works, every job, every time.

Step 1: Same-Day Phone Consultation and Flat Quote

Call us with your test result (pCi/L number, test date, foundation type) and we'll quote your Riverlea home over the phone. Most quotes are issued within 30 minutes. No on-site sales visit required for standard residential jobs.

Step 2: System Design and Suction Point Diagnostic

On install day, our RC202-licensed technician performs a pressure field extension (PFE) test to confirm the suction point will pull radon from under the entire slab. This step is skipped by 70% of low-bid mitigators, which is why their systems fail re-tests.

Step 3: Code-Compliant Installation (One Day)

Slab core, PVC riser, sealed suction pit, exterior radon fan, U-tube manometer, electrical disconnect, and labeled system per AARST SGM-SF-2017. Standard Riverlea install: 4–6 hours.

Step 4: Post-Mitigation Re-Test

A continuous radon monitor is placed 24 hours after install for a 48-hour closed-house test. You receive a signed report showing the new pCi/L level — typically under 2.0, often under 1.0 — which you forward to your agent, buyer, or compliance file.

Local Expertise: Why Riverlea Homes Need Radon Mitigation

Riverlea is a small, tree-lined village of roughly 500 homes tucked between Worthington and Clintonville along the Olentangy River. The geology underneath — glacial till over Ohio shale — is exactly the formation that produces elevated indoor radon. We have mitigated homes on Olentangy Boulevard, Hayhurst Drive, Riverlea Road, and across the High Street corridor into Worthington and the Old Worthington historic district.

Most Riverlea houses were built between 1925 and 1965, with poured concrete or block foundations, partial basements, and the occasional crawlspace addition. These foundations have natural radon entry points: cove joints, sump pits, slab cracks from seven decades of settlement, and unsealed plumbing penetrations. That's why so many Riverlea radon tests come back in the 5–10 pCi/L range — not because the homes are defective, but because the soil gas has nowhere else to go.

What should I look for in radon mitigation services?

A diagnostic pressure field extension test before installation, a sealed suction point (not just a fan in a vent stack), a U-tube manometer for ongoing monitoring, exterior fan placement per AARST code, and a written warranty. Anything less is a fan swap, not mitigation.

Is 4.2 pCi/L actually dangerous?

The EPA action level is 4.0 pCi/L. At 4.2, the EPA recommends mitigation. The risk is cumulative over years of exposure, not immediate, but the recommendation is direct — and in Ohio real estate transactions, anything at or above 4.0 typically triggers a buyer mitigation request.
